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ost in Cookeville, TN
The cost of ceiling drywall water damage restoration in Cookeville, TN can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ide you with a free estimate to find out the cost of the restoration. Here are some estimated price ranges for different services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water extracted,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Drywall repair and repl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of drywall damaged,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Painting and finishing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the number of coats required, and local conditions. |
| Mold remediation | $1,000 – $5,000 | The severity of the mold infestation,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Emergency response and assessment | $200 – $1,000 | The time of day, the severity of the damage, and local conditions. |
